Variation of AIIC Inventory listing following revocation of CBI approval and variation of Inventory terms (SIR details added)

Description

AICIS published a notice that the Executive Director varied an Australian Inventory of Industrial Chemicals (AIIC) listing following revocation of a confidential business information (CBI) approval (Industrial Chemicals Act 2019 s94, relating to proper name), and then varied Inventory listing terms (s85) to add additional detail about Specific Information Requirements (SIRs) for two listed chemicals. The notice includes explicit written-notification obligations (e.g., to tell AICIS in writing within 28 calendar days) tied to listing conditions/secondary-notification-type triggers. Compliance teams should review affected Inventory listings and ensure internal procedures can meet any specified written notification timelines and content requirements.
